Win8.1用户必看:如何高效安装与使用MySQL数据库

mysql for win8.1

时间:2025-07-03 07:35


MySQL for Windows8.1:卓越性能与无缝集成的数据库解决方案 在当今快速发展的信息技术领域,数据库管理系统(DBMS)扮演着至关重要的角色

    无论是企业级应用、个人项目还是大数据分析,一个高效、稳定且易于管理的数据库都是成功的基础

    MySQL,作为开源数据库管理系统中的佼佼者,凭借其卓越的性能、广泛的兼容性和灵活的扩展性,在全球范围内赢得了无数用户的青睐

    特别是在Windows8.1操作系统环境下,MySQL展现了其无与伦比的优势,为开发者提供了强大的支持

    本文将深入探讨MySQL在Windows8.1平台上的应用优势、安装配置、性能优化以及最佳实践,旨在帮助读者充分利用这一强大工具,提升项目效率和数据管理能力

     一、MySQL与Windows8.1的完美融合 1. 系统兼容性 Windows8.1作为微软推出的操作系统,不仅继承了Windows8的现代化界面设计,还通过一系列更新和改进,提升了用户体验和系统稳定性

    MySQL官方提供了针对Windows平台的安装包,确保了与Windows8.1的完全兼容

    这意味着,无论是专业开发者还是初学者,都可以在无需担心兼容性问题的情况下,轻松安装并运行MySQL数据库

     2. 无缝集成 Windows8.1的“开始”屏幕、任务管理器以及文件资源管理器等特性,为用户提供了直观的操作界面

    MySQL的安装程序巧妙地将自身集成到这些系统组件中,使得数据库的管理和维护变得更加便捷

    例如,通过任务管理器,用户可以轻松监控MySQL服务的运行状态;而文件资源管理器则便于用户访问MySQL的数据目录和配置文件,进行必要的调整和优化

     3. 安全性增强 Windows8.1引入了一系列安全增强功能,包括改进的防火墙设置、用户账户控制(UAC)以及增强的反恶意软件工具

    这些安全措施为MySQL数据库的运行提供了额外的保护层

    MySQL本身也提供了丰富的安全特性,如密码加密、访问控制列表(ACLs)和SSL/TLS加密连接,确保数据在传输过程中的安全性

    结合Windows8.1的安全机制,MySQL能够为敏感数据提供全方位的保护

     二、安装与配置指南 1. 下载安装包 首先,从MySQL官方网站下载适用于Windows平台的安装包

    建议选择MySQL Installer for Windows,这是一个集成安装向导,允许用户根据需要选择安装MySQL Server、MySQL Workbench、MySQL Shell等组件

     2. 执行安装 运行下载的安装包,按照向导提示完成安装过程

    在安装过程中,用户需要选择MySQL Server的安装类型(如Developer Default、Server only、Full等),并设置root用户的密码

    此外,还可以选择配置InnoDB存储引擎、配置MySQL服务为自动启动等选项

     3. 环境变量配置 为了方便在命令行中访问MySQL,建议将MySQL的安装目录(通常是`C:Program FilesMySQLMySQL Server X.Y`)添加到系统的PATH环境变量中

    这样,用户就可以在任何目录下通过命令行启动MySQL客户端工具

     4. 基本配置调整 安装完成后,可能需要根据实际需求调整MySQL的配置文件(my.ini或my.cnf)

    常见调整包括设置字符集(如utf8mb4)、调整缓冲池大小、配置连接限制等

    这些调整有助于提高数据库的性能和稳定性

     三、性能优化策略 1. 硬件资源分配 MySQL的性能很大程度上依赖于服务器的硬件配置

    在Windows8.1环境下,确保为MySQL分配足够的内存(RAM)和CPU资源

    对于内存密集型应用,可以考虑增加物理内存或调整MySQL的内存分配参数(如innodb_buffer_pool_size)

     2. 索引优化 合理的索引设计能够显著提高查询速度

    分析查询日志,识别频繁访问的表和字段,并为其创建适当的索引

    同时,定期检查和重建碎片化的索引,保持数据库的高效运行

     3. 查询优化 优化SQL查询语句是提升MySQL性能的关键

    使用EXPLAIN命令分析查询计划,识别潜在的瓶颈,如全表扫描、不必要的联接等

    通过重写查询、使用子查询或临时表等技术,优化查询逻辑

     4. 日志管理与监控 MySQL生成多种日志文件,包括错误日志、查询日志、慢查询日志等

    定期审查这些日志,可以帮助识别并解决潜在问题

    同时,利用Windows任务计划程序定期归档和清理旧日志,避免日志文件占用过多磁盘空间

     5. 备份与恢复策略 制定有效的备份计划是保障数据安全的关键

    MySQL支持多种备份方式,包括逻辑备份(使用mysqldump)、物理备份(使用Percona XtraBackup等工具)和快照备份

    根据业务需求和数据量大小,选择合适的备份策略,并定期测试恢复过程,确保备份的有效性

     四、最佳实践分享 1. 使用MySQL Workbench MySQL Workbench是一款强大的图形化管理工具,支持数据库设计、SQL开发、服务器配置、用户管理等多种功能

    在Windows8.1上,MySQL Workbench提供了无缝的用户体验,使得数据库管理更加直观和高效

     2. 定期更新与升级 保持MySQL版本的最新状态,是享受最新功能和安全修复的关键

    定期检查MySQL官方网站,了解最新的发布信息,并按照官方指南执行升级操作

     3. 社区支持与文档资源 MySQL拥有一个活跃的社区,成员包括开发者、数据库管理员和爱好者

    遇到问题时,可以访问MySQL官方论坛、Stack Overflow等平台寻求帮助

    同时,MySQL官方文档是学习和解决问题的宝贵资源,涵盖了从安装到高级配置的各个方面

     4. 实施访问控制和审计 为了增强数据库的安全性,应实施严格的访问控制策略,确保只有授权用户能够访问敏感数据

    此外,启用审计日志记录,监控数据库操作,及时发现并响应潜在的安全威胁

     5. 性能基准测试 在进行重大更改(如升级硬件、调整配置参数、迁移数据等)之前,进行性能基准测试是非常重要的

    通过模拟实际负载,评估数据库在不同条件下的性能表现,为决策提供数据支持

     结语 MySQL for Windows8.1凭借其出色的兼容性、无缝集成、强大的性能和丰富的功能,成为开发者在Windows平台上管理数据库的首选解决方案

    通过遵循本文提供的安装配置指南、性能优化策略和最佳实践,用户可以充分利用MySQL的优势,构建高效、安全的数据存储和处理系统

    无论是在个人项目还是企业级应用中,MySQL都能够提供稳定可靠的支持,助力用户实现数据